[Samba] Best Update Strategy

Andrew Bartlett abartlet at samba.org
Wed Aug 9 05:05:33 UTC 2023


These are harmless.  This lastKnownParent is mostly just metadata for
forensics, the old value is probably the best regardless Samba re-
calculates the string value if it points at something it can resolve at
runtime. 
Andrew,
On Wed, 2023-08-09 at 06:57 +0200, Dirk Laurenz via samba wrote:
> Hi,
> 
> So everything worked and both DCs are running now on bullseye 64bit.
> So these are the last problems. How do i solve them? Simply delete?
> root at dc01:~# samba-tool dbcheck --cross-ncsChecking 3688 objectsNOTE:
> old (due to rename or delete) DN string component for
> lastKnownParentin object CN=NTDSSettings\0ADEL:4adb764b-36d4-4276-
> 92e1-36aef50520d7,CN=DC02\0ADEL:e706c1e1-0c2e-4b74-b525-
> 17d4b0fa4fff,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ba
> ,DC=laurenz,DC=ws
> -CN=DC02,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ba,DC=
> laurenz,DC=wsNot fixing old string componentNOTE: old (due to rename
> or delete) DN string component for lastKnownParentin
> objectCN=cd4cd8e3-ea9a-4dda-929f-70413c9323d0\0ADEL:ff4bd7bd-84a2-
> 4f3d-8277-2febc74bee3b,CN=Deleted
> Objects,CN=Configuration,DC=samba,DC=laurenz,DC=ws
> -CN=NTDSSettings,CN=DC02,CN=Servers,CN=ZuHause,CN=Sites,CN=Configurat
> ion,DC=samba,DC=laurenz,DC=wsNot fixing old string componentNOTE: old
> (due to rename or delete) DN string component for lastKnownParentin
> objectCN=3d2379a1-a17c-4088-93ce-1bc32a1b2ec5\0ADEL:37ada2d6-f865-
> 4f35-88d8-83d35ee81ee5,CN=Deleted
> Objects,CN=Configuration,DC=samba,DC=laurenz,DC=ws
> -CN=NTDSSettings,CN=DC01,CN=Servers,CN=ZuHause,CN=Sites,CN=Configurat
> ion,DC=samba,DC=laurenz,DC=wsNot fixing old string componentNOTE: old
> (due to rename or delete) DN string component for lastKnownParentin
> object CN=NTDSSettings\0ADEL:011bab7b-5812-481a-99b8-
> 33fc2cba2638,CN=DC01\0ADEL:203569c6-2c83-41b5-b599-
> e2c32e3d734f,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ba
> ,DC=laurenz,DC=ws
> -CN=DC01,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ba,DC=
> laurenz,DC=wsNot fixing old string componentNOTE: old (due to rename
> or delete) DN string component for lastKnownParentin object
> CN=NTDSSettings\0ADEL:b34e65ff-becb-479b-a101-
> f9670c845365,CN=DC01\0ADEL:d7eb2e4b-81db-4d35-826e-
> 302bed160515,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ba
> ,DC=laurenz,DC=ws
> -CN=DC01,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ba,DC=
> laurenz,DC=wsNot fixing old string componentNOTE: old (due to rename
> or delete) DN string component for lastKnownParentin
> objectCN=355c61cd-513f-4e60-9741-037d36e787ca\0ADEL:49c768df-8f4d-
> 4058-99cd-5aba3e21e830,CN=Deleted
> Objects,CN=Configuration,DC=samba,DC=laurenz,DC=ws
> -CN=NTDSSettings,CN=DC01,CN=Servers,CN=ZuHause,CN=Sites,CN=Configurat
> ion,DC=samba,DC=laurenz,DC=wsNot fixing old string componentNOTE: old
> (due to rename or delete) DN string component for lastKnownParentin
> object CN=NTDSSettings\0ADEL:cd9cba21-d4d4-4704-8714-
> fa803d0e1511,CN=DC02\0ADEL:f5452801-dc3f-4c47-b011-
> a0560de2934f,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ba
> ,DC=laurenz,DC=ws
> -CN=DC02,CN=Servers,CN=ZuHause,CN=Sites,CN=Configuration,DC=samba,DC=
> laurenz,DC=wsNot fixing old string componentNOTE: old (due to rename
> or delete) DN string component for lastKnownParentin object CN=RID
> Set\0ADEL:36eab6d3-04ac-4c9b-a2f9-
> 3795515e7a2b,CN=DeletedObjects,DC=samba,DC=laurenz,DC=ws -
> CN=DC01,OU=DomainControllers,DC=samba,DC=laurenz,DC=wsNot fixing old
> string componentNOTE: old (due to rename or delete) DN string
> component for rIDSetReferencesin object
> CN=DC03,CN=Computers,DC=samba,DC=laurenz,DC=ws -
> CN=RIDSet,CN=DC03,OU=Domain Controllers,DC=samba,DC=laurenz,DC=wsNot
> fixing old string componentNOTE: old (due to rename or delete) DN
> string component for lastKnownParentin object CN=RID
> Set\0ADEL:ea3d7b75-9a93-46ec-bf5d-
> c64b5a6d4842,CN=DeletedObjects,DC=samba,DC=laurenz,DC=ws
> -CN=DC02,CN=Computers,DC=samba,DC=laurenz,DC=wsNot fixing old string
> componentChecked 3688 objects (0 errors)
> -----Ursprüngliche Nachricht-----Von: samba <
> samba-bounces at lists.samba.org> Im Auftrag von Rowland Penny
> viasambaGesendet: Montag, 7. August 2023 13:00An: 
> samba at lists.samba.org
> Cc: Rowland Penny <rpenny at samba.org>Betreff: Re: [Samba] Best Update
> Strategy
> 
> 
> On 07/08/2023 11:52, Dirk Laurenz via samba wrote:
> > Hi,
> >   
> > due to the fact that i need to upgrade from 32bit Debian 10 to
> > 64bit Debian11 (on Raspberry PI) i have to completly reinstall both
> > DCs and a crossgrade is not supported.
> >   
> > So i would do the following:
> >   
> > Remove a DC from the Domain
> > Install new 64 bit Raspberry OS
> > Install Samba
> > Rejoin the Domain with newer Samba Version
> 
> I used the same method when I upgraded, except I did the upgrade on
> RPI4'susing a USB drive to install the OS to an SSD.
> Rowland
> 
> --To unsubscribe from this list go to the following URL and read
> theinstructions:  https://lists.samba.org/mailman/options/samba
> 
> 
-- 
Andrew Bartlett (he/him)       https://samba.org/~abartlet/Samba Team Member (since 2001) https://samba.orgSamba Team Lead                https://catalyst.net.nz/services/sambaCatalyst.Net Ltd
Proudly developing Samba for Catalyst.Net Ltd - a Catalyst IT group
company
Samba Development and Support: https://catalyst.net.nz/services/samba
Catalyst IT - Expert Open Source Solutions


More information about the samba mailing list